These photo card templates can be easily customized in Photoshop with your own photos and words. They’re a part of the February Plum Pickins’ and are only $2 this month. I made some of the ticket cards for my oldest daughter. I just added her picture, her name and printed them out on 4×6″ photo paper. Once printed, I just used a paper cutter to slice the photo in half. Two valentines for the price of one! Here’s a preview of all the cards included:

So, on to January’s releases. Both of my releases for January were for collaborations, either for Polka Dot Plum or for The Digiscrap Addicts monthly promotional newsletter called The Fix. They highlight a few different stores or designers in their newsletter and then sell a huge collaboration kit with portions contributed by all the designers shown. It’s a great deal if you’re looking to “test” out a few “new-to-you” designers in a great big package, all for $5.00. Anyway, here is a preview of my portion:
